what does 'apron' mean - is it just adding a bottom section of hardware cloth? .. I am going to be building a run soon and wanted to know how every one is building the runs to keep out 'digging' preditors?


Nice beer holder by the way!
 
Yeah Shelly we are going to go around the bottom and out a few feet with wire to stop digging critters. My main concern is coop security as the gals will be locked up at night in the coop. We have ALOT of raccoons around here so Pretty much short of poured concrete and chainlink theyll we get in the run sooner or later. Thats one of the reasons im bottom hinging my pop door with piano hinge edge to edge. I figure this way they wount be able to stand up and grab a corner to rip the door off.

I think what "apron" means is that you attach wire to the bottom of your coop, dig down and run it out 2 feet from the outside. That way if an animal tries to dig at the base of your coop/run, they cant...even if they take a step or two back. Also, you'll want to put some heavier wire over the chicken wire around the lower half of your run...chicken wire can be easily ripped by predators, even dogs.
